Cross-Border Commercial Contracts under Iranian Law: Key Considerations

Cross-border commercial contracts involving Iranian parties present unique legal challenges. Issues such as governing law, language requirements, and dispute resolution mechanisms must be carefully addressed to ensure enforceability and protect the interests of all parties.

Governing Law and Jurisdiction Issues

While parties may choose foreign law in many cases, certain mandatory rules of Iranian law still apply. Understanding these limitations is crucial when drafting international contracts.

Key Clauses in Cross-Border Contracts

Essential clauses include clear definitions of obligations, payment terms, force majeure provisions, confidentiality, and termination rights. Special attention should also be given to compliance with Iranian regulatory requirements.

Language and Translation Requirements

In many cases, contracts must be translated into Persian for official or regulatory purposes. Ensuring the accuracy of translations is important to avoid future disputes.

Dispute Resolution Mechanisms

Arbitration is often preferred in cross-border contracts due to its flexibility and international enforceability. However, litigation in Iranian courts remains an option depending on the nature of the dispute.
